These have been announced as championships, however that was questioned as a outcome of the occasions had been every promoted by a single club and on an invitational basis. It was from the controversy roused by these promotions that the United States Golf Association (USGA) was instituted in 1894. Amateur and Open championships and to formulate a set of rules for the sport. The founding fathers, two from each club, had been from St. Andrew’s, Shinnecock Hills, Chicago, the Country Club at Brookline, and Newport. The U.S. nationwide championships—the Amateur, the Women’s Amateur, and the Open—were inaugurated in 1895. Grant’s invention elevated the common player’s chances of getting the ball airborne. On the European continent the first golf course was laid in France at Pau in 1856. Until 1913, when the rely of Gallifet was admitted as a member, the club "Golf de Pau" remained the preserve of Scottish residents on the foot of the Pyrenees, a few of whom have been descendants of Wellington’s army. Biarritz Golf Club came into being in 1888, and Cannes Golf Club was based by the "King of Cannes," the Russian grandduke Michael, in 1891.

The shallow prime soil and sandy subsoil made links land unsuitable for the cultivation of crops or for urban development and was of low economic worth. The links were typically handled as widespread land by the residents of the nearby towns and had been used by them for recreation, animal grazing and other activities corresponding to laundering garments. A commercial course is owned and managed by a non-public group and is operated for revenue. They could also be constructed to offer a core or Stars and Bars Collection & 8211; flopshotgolfapparel.com supplementary attraction for visitors to a lodge or industrial resort, because the centrepiece to an actual property growth, as an unique Country Club, or as a "Pay and Play" course open to most people.
